Manu Chak

Manu Chak is a village located in Nandigram I subdivision of Purba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Tamluk and Nandigram are the district & sub-district headquarters of Manu Chak village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Bhakutia is the gram panchayat of Manu Chak village.

About Manu Chak

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Manu Chak is 345763. The village spans a total geographical area of 149.48 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721656. Haldia is nearest town to Manu Chak village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.

Population of Manu Chak

According to the 2011 Census, Manu Chak has a total population of about 1,373, with approximately 705 males and 668 females. The sex ratio is around 947 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 156 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 8 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 82.45%, with male literacy at about 84.96% and female literacy near 79.79%. There are around 312 households in the village. Connectivity of Manu Chak

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Manu Chak. As per the 2011 stats, Manu Chak had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
